Below is a comparative overview of how different board configurations affect gameplay. Understanding these variations can help you tailor your approach to your personal risk tolerance.
| Board Type | Peg Density | Multiplier Range | Typical Volatility |
|---|---|---|---|
| Classic Symmetrical | Moderate (evenly spaced) | Low to Medium | Low |
| High-Risk Edge | Dense at center, sparse on edges | Low to Extreme | High |
| Cascading Multipliers | Variable with active zones | Medium to Very High | Medium-High |
| Progressive Jackpot | Standard layout with special slot | Low plus pooled jackpot | Variable |
Each board type offers a distinct flavor. The Classic Symmetrical board is ideal for newcomers, providing steady, predictable results with fewer wild swings. The High-Risk Edge board, on the other hand, is designed for thrill-seekers who dream of hitting the top prize. The middle slots might pay out frequently but modestly, while the outer edges can remain empty for dozens of drops before suddenly delivering a windfall.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is the outcome truly random, or can I influence it?
The outcome is determined by a random number generator at the moment of release. While you may choose where to drop the ball, the final landing position is completely random and cannot be influenced by timing or angle.
What is the typical house edge for these games?
The house edge varies by platform and specific game rules. It is generally comparable to traditional slot machines, but you should always check the game’s information panel for exact figures.
Can I play for free before risking real money?
Many platforms offer demo or practice modes that allow you to play with virtual credits. This is an excellent way to understand the mechanics and volatility without financial risk.
Are there strategies to improve my chances?
Since the outcome is random, no strategy can guarantee wins. However, understanding volatility and bankroll management can help you play more sustainably. Choosing low-volatility boards may extend your playtime.
Do bonus rounds offer better odds?
Bonus rounds typically have their own set of rules and multipliers, but the underlying randomness remains. They can provide more excitement and potential for larger wins, but the odds are not necessarily better than the base game.
How do I know if a platform is trustworthy?
Look for platforms that display licensing information from recognized regulatory bodies. Independent audits and certifications for fairness are also good indicators of a reputable operator.
